A vintage ceramic haven - L'Gazette Dumaguete

Along EJ Blanco road in Dumaguete, you'll find this nice little place called L'Gazette Dumaguete, which is a beautiful house turned into a ceramic shop. Inside is a wide array of ceramic finds, mostly vintage – tea towels, lamps, carpets, plates, bowls, cups, cuttlery and more, displayed in vntage furniture and stlyed with wonderful flowers. 

I visited in the afternoon and the place catches great light in some areas of the house. I couldn't resist those patches of light that fall on the chairs; the sunshine that makes you feel warm and fuzzy just by looking at it.

You can also grab a bit because they also serve coffee, snacks and light meals. They have seating inside and outside. I loved taking photos of everything! (as you will see that I posted plenty of photos here).  I got a few small pieces of decorative mini saucers, which I plan to use in mixing watercolor paints when I'm painting.
